East London Waste Authority are working in partnership with four London boroughs - Barking & Dagenham, Havering, Newham and Redbridge to bring repair opportunities to local residents.

Through our Repair Cafes we hope to inspire others to share the repair message and set up their own repair cafes within our local communities.

If you are interested in supporting our repair cafes do get in touch - we'd love to hear from you.

Volunteering opportunities include:

Electrical Repair : help to fix electrical items

If you feel you need more experience you can be paired up with an experienced fixer

Data recording: to be able to measure the impact we record the age of the item, the issue, whether it can be repaired, what work is carried out and next steps.

All this information helps generate an accurate environmental impact score, including the waste prevented in KG and the estimated CO2 emissions prevented.

General event support: supporting with set up, signposting residents to the relevant information about reduce, reuse and repair initiatives and replenishing refreshments is a vital role within our Repair Cafes
